Comprehending Parrot Species
Parrots belong to the order Psittaciformes, which incorporates approximately 393 types divided into three families: Psittacidae (true parrots), Cacatuidae (cockatoos), and Strigopidae (New Zealand parrots). Each types is distinct, with its own set of qualities, natural habitats, and care requirements.

Lovebirds (Genus Agapornis)
Lovebirds are little, social birds originally from Africa. They are understood for their affectionate habits and strong set bonds. Adult lovebirds generally reach a size of 5 to 7 inches and have a life expectancy of 10 to 15 years. These birds can be trained to carry out tricks and are known for their playful nature.
2. Macaws (Family: Psittacidae)
Macaws are big, stunning parrots that show lively plumage and effective beaks. Species such as the Blue and Gold Macaw and Scarlet Macaw are extremely searched for for their beauty and intelligence. Macaws require adequate space and social interaction, making them appropriate for experienced bird owners.
3. African Grey Parrots
Prominent for their impressive mimicry and smart habits, African Grey Parrots are medium-sized birds with a reputation for being exceptional talkers. Their average size is around 12-14 inches, and they can live for over 40 years. They thrive on mental stimulation and social interaction.
4. Cockatoos (Family: Cacatuidae)
Cockatoos are defined by their crests and affectionate nature. They are understood for their social behaviors and can be highly requiring of attention. Popular types consist of the Umbrella Cockatoo and Moluccan Cockatoo. Cockatoos are generally larger, ranging from 12 to 24 inches and have a lifespan of 20 to 70 years, depending upon the species.

Not all parrot types appropriate as pets. Some need more attention and care than others. Consider your way of life and experience with birds before choosing a types.
Q2: How long do parrots live?
Parrot life expectancies differ by types. Budgerigars live 5-10 years, while African Grey Parrots can live 40-60 years. Careful consideration of their lifespan is essential for potential owners.
Q3: Can parrots talk?
Numerous parrot types can simulating human speech. The African Grey Parrot is particularly understood for its exceptional talking ability, while others, like budgerigars, can likewise learn a couple of words.
Q4: Are parrots untidy?
Yes, parrots can be messy eaters. Regular cleaning of their cages and surrounding locations is necessary to preserve hygiene.
Q5: What should I feed my parrot?
A well-balanced diet plan includes high-quality pellets, fresh fruits, and veggies. Avoid feeding them avocado, chocolate, and other foods damaging to birds.
